PATIENT PERSPECTIVE
Vicki Furmanek

At the time (of my diagnosis), I was working full time in my profession as a hair stylist.  After the first surgery, I found that I was experiencing limitations in raising my arms, felt like I was in a too-tight scuba suit and experienced reduced overall stamina.  But I but I didn't know if that was normal or not.  Within a one week period, I heard about TurningPoint from a friend and then from a doctor, and realized there was somewhere to go for help.

QUESTIONING NUTRITION 

August Nutrition Q&A

with TurningPoint Dietitian Lisa Eisele

 

Q:  Can I really eat Hemp?  How can something used for weaving baskets be healthy for me?  Is it safe for breast cancer patients/survivors?

 

A:   Surprising source of protein!

 

Yes, you can.  During treatment I recommend hemp to my breast cancer patients to help them meet their increased protein needs, and for my survivors I recommend it as a "non- meat" alternative to a healthy diet.

Our Mission
TurningPoint Breast Cancer Rehabiltation is a non-profit 501(c)3 community-based organization. TurningPoint improves quality of life for women with breast cancer by providing, promoting and advocating evidence-based and specialized rehabilitation.TurningPoint was founded in 2003 and has served over 2,500 women with breast cancer in the Greater Atlanta community and educated hundreds of healthcare providers in the United States.
